Like Costco, Sam’s Club is a members-only warehouse club where you can shop and save money on everyday items, including winter outfits.

Here’s what you should consider adding to your Sam’s Club shopping list before the cold arrives

Eddie Bauer Women’s Snow Boots

  • Price: $44.98

If you dread wet and icy mornings, you need these Eddie Bauer snow boots. They feature sturdy tracked soles for grip, a weather-repellant exterior that keeps moisture out, and insulation that keeps your feet warm and comfortable even in the coldest temperatures. 

“I bought these for working outside this winter. They resist water, have a warm lining and look good. They were reasonably priced and I bought a different style from the same company last year I was very happy with,” a satisfied customer reviewed. 

Free Country Snow Gloves

  • Price: $16.98

When your hands are freezing, your entire body also feels colder. These Free Country snow gloves are designed to withstand the elements. The thumb and index finger are made with faux leather conductive fabric that lets you use your smartphone without removing your gloves. This way, you can keep your fingers nice and warm no matter what activity you’re doing in the cold.

Lucky Brand Women’s Hat and Scarf Set

  • Price: $16.96

This Lucky Brand hat and scarf set comes with both a knit beanie and a matching blanket scarf to keep you cozy this winter. The scarf can also double as a shawl or wrap. This hat and scarf set also makes a nice holiday gift. Since it already comes in a ready-to-wrap box, you can just add some ribbon to make it look presentable.

Member’s Mark Women’s Extra Warm Jacket

  • Price: $14.98 (regularly $16.98)

If you want to stay cozy without spending hundreds of dollars, this jacket from Member’s Mark is a pretty solid deal. It’s not a premium down puffer that you could wear alone in freezing temperatures, but it’s good enough for layering and lounging around at home. It also comes with extended sleeves with thumbholes that help keep your hands warm and invisible on-seam pockets to stash your stuff.

Free Country Men’s 2-Pack Base Layer Top

  • Price: $14.98

This Free Country microtech heat base layer top keeps your core warm without making you feel bulky, and it also wicks moisture so you stay comfortable if you’re in and out or layering under coats. It’s perfect for chilly days when you’re doing errands or working outdoors. 

“These microtech shirts are super soft. The inside of the shirts are like a fleece material but super lightweight. They definitely keep you warm even before you add a layering piece. I highly suggest this layering shirt to keep you warm and comfortable,” a Sam’s Club customer reviewed.
